Aerial Robotics Courses

Aerial robotics courses can help you learn drone design, flight dynamics, navigation systems, and sensor integration. You can build skills in programming for autonomous flight, data collection techniques, and real-time decision-making. Many courses introduce tools like MATLAB for simulations, ROS for robotic systems, and various drone platforms, allowing you to apply your skills in practical scenarios such as aerial mapping, surveillance, and environmental monitoring.

Frequently Asked Questions about Aerial Robotics

Aerial robotics refers to the design, development, and operation of flying robots, commonly known as drones. This field is important because it has applications across various industries, including agriculture, logistics, surveillance, and environmental monitoring. Aerial robotics enhances efficiency, safety, and data collection capabilities, making it a vital area of innovation in today's technology-driven world.‎

Careers in aerial robotics are diverse and growing. You could pursue roles such as drone operator, robotics engineer, software developer, or systems analyst. Additionally, positions in research and development, project management, and regulatory compliance are also available. As industries increasingly adopt aerial robotics, the demand for skilled professionals continues to rise.‎

To thrive in aerial robotics, you should develop a mix of technical and soft skills. Key technical skills include programming (Python, C++), knowledge of robotics principles, and understanding of aerodynamics. Familiarity with machine learning and data analysis can also be beneficial. Soft skills such as problem-solving, teamwork, and communication are equally important, as they help you collaborate effectively in multidisciplinary teams.‎

Typical topics covered in aerial robotics courses include drone design, flight dynamics, control systems, and sensor integration. You may also learn about programming for autonomous navigation, data collection techniques, and regulatory considerations in drone operations. These topics equip you with the knowledge needed to excel in the field.‎
